Action for which recommended -
At Henu Chaung on 18 April 44 Lieut. Virgo was in command of the Support Troop of his Regiment during the attack on Japanese positions. During this action the fire of the Support Troop was instrumental in breaking up several determined counter attacks by the enemy on the position gained by the Coln. Lieut. Virgo was himself severely wounded in the early stages of the action by a burst of machine gun fire through the shoulder. He refused to leave his troop and continued to direct the fire of his guns. This display of personal courage and leadership was a fine example to all ranks.
This was the second action in three weeks in which the fire of his guns had considerable effect owing to his skilful handling.
(Signed) C.R.Cumberlege Lieut.Col.,
Commanding 45th Reconnaissance Regiment, R.A.C., 28 May 1944
